Google Search as You Know It Is Over
The End of Ten Blue Links
Google has unveiled the biggest transformation to Search in 25 years at its I/O conference. The familiar list of blue links is being replaced by an AI-powered, conversational interface that fundamentally changes how people interact with information on the web.
Key Changes to Google Search
Intelligent Search Box
- Conversational Queries: The search box now expands to accommodate longer, more natural language queries
- AI-Powered Suggestions: Goes beyond autocomplete to help craft complex, nuanced queries
- AI Mode: Users can ask follow-up questions directly within AI Overviews (launching Tuesday)
Information Agents (Rolling Out Summer 2026)
- 24/7 Autonomous Monitoring: AI agents work in the background to track web changes and alert users
- Custom Parameters: Users can set specific conditions (e.g., market movements, sector tracking)
- Synthesized Updates: Agents provide summaries with relevant links instead of requiring manual searches
- Evolution of Google Alerts: Modern AI-powered version of the 2003 change-detection service
Generative UI (User Interface)
- Custom Interactive Experiences: Dynamic layouts and visualizations built on-the-fly
- Real-time Visuals: Interactive widgets respond to follow-up questions with new visuals
- Example Use Case: Asking about black holes generates interactive visual explanations
- Powered by: Gemini Flash 3.5 in partnership with Google DeepMind
- Free for All Users: Rolling out summer 2026

Current Adoption Metrics
- AI Overviews: 2.5+ billion monthly users
- AI Mode (Conversational Search): 1+ billion monthly users
- Comparison: ChatGPT has 900M weekly active users (suggesting higher engagement frequency)
Impact on Publishers
- Declining Referral Traffic: AI Overviews already reducing clicks to websites
- Accelerated Decline Expected: New features will keep users within Google's interface even longer
- Shift from Information Retrieval to Action: Users focus on acting on AI-provided information rather than clicking links
- AI Agents as Intermediaries: Machines increasingly perform web searches instead of humans
